Doug. It always helps to give a link to the file you're talking about. I assume you mean this one? http://simviation.com/1/search?submit=1&keywords=pa28r201pack.zip&categoryId=&filename=Y

It's not clear from the file description that this is an FS9 model with the usual display bugs in FSX + SP2. This can be fixed in the usual way by editing the Alpha channel of the prop disc texture.

This is what my modified prop disc looks like.
Image

As you can see it's not perfect & it still has the familiar display bugs with clouds & autogen scenery.
